What are the wagering requirements on the Prime Casino welcome bonus?

The welcome bonus at Prime Casino carries a 35x wagering requirement on the bonus amount only. If you deposit £100 and receive £100 in bonus funds, you must wager £3,500 before withdrawing any winnings derived from the bonus. This is more favourable than Betway Casino’s 50x requirement, but less generous than the 20x terms offered by Casumo Casino.

Game contributions vary significantly. Slots from Pragmatic Play, NetEnt and Microgaming contribute 100% toward wagering, while table games like blackjack and roulette contribute only 10%. Live dealer games from Evolution Gaming contribute 20%, and jackpot slots contribute nothing. If you deposit £100 and play only blackjack, your effective wagering requirement jumps from £3,500 to £35,000 — a critical detail that casual players often overlook.

Player Rights and Dispute Resolution at Prime Casino

UK law grants players specific protections when gambling at licensed casinos. Under the Gambling Act 2005, you have the right to fair treatment, timely withdrawals and access to dispute resolution. Prime Casino, as a UKGC licensee, must honour these rights or face regulatory action that can include fines, licence suspension or revocation.

The casino’s terms and conditions include a clause that allows it to withhold withdrawals if it suspects fraud or bonus abuse. However, the UKGC requires operators to provide clear evidence before freezing funds. In practice, Prime Casino must notify you within 48 hours of any hold and provide a detailed explanation. If you disagree with the decision, you can escalate the matter to an independent adjudicator.

Prime Casino is a member of the Independent Betting Adjudication Service (IBAS), which has been resolving gambling disputes since 1998. IBAS is free to use and has the authority to make binding decisions on disputes up to £10,000. Cases typically take 8-12 weeks to resolve, though simpler issues are settled within 4 weeks.

What happens if Prime Casino rejects your withdrawal request?

If Prime Casino rejects a withdrawal, you will receive an email explaining the specific reason. Common grounds include unverified documents, wagering requirements not met, or suspected bonus abuse. The casino must provide evidence for its decision, and you have the right to request a detailed account review within 14 days of the rejection.

You can challenge the decision by contacting customer support and requesting escalation to the compliance team. The compliance team must respond within 72 hours with a final decision. If you remain unsatisfied, you can submit a complaint to IBAS within 12 months of the rejection date. IBAS will review the case, request documentation from both parties, and issue a binding ruling.

How do you escalate a complaint to IBAS?

To escalate a dispute to IBAS, you must first exhaust Prime Casino’s internal complaints procedure. This involves submitting a formal complaint through the casino’s support channels and allowing 8 weeks for a resolution. If the casino does not respond or you disagree with its decision, you can submit a complaint form on the IBAS website.

IBAS requires you to provide your account details, a chronological summary of events and copies of all relevant correspondence. The service is free, and you do not need legal representation. IBAS aims to issue a decision within 8 weeks of receiving your complaint, though complex cases involving large sums may take longer. The adjudicator’s decision is binding on Prime Casino, meaning it must comply or face losing its UKGC licence.

What deposit limits can you set at Prime Casino?

Prime Casino allows you to set daily, weekly or monthly deposit limits. The minimum daily limit is £10, while the maximum is £10,000. Weekly limits range from £20 to £50,000, and monthly limits from £50 to £100,000. You can decrease your limit at any time with immediate effect, but increases take 24 hours to process — a cooling-off period required by UKGC regulations.

Deposit limits apply across all games and cannot be bypassed by using different payment methods. The casino tracks your total deposits across debit cards, e-wallets and prepaid cards. If you attempt to deposit beyond your limit, the transaction is blocked automatically. These protections are mandatory under UKGC licence condition 12.1.1, which applies to all operators including Prime Casino.
